    Hi. I'm capturing this VHS tape with a panasonic VCR connected to an ES10 & USB Live-2
    The issue i'm having is the line running across about 3/4 down the tape.
    I cannot fix this by adjusting the tracking.
    I'm wonder if it's actually a tape issue.
    Thank you

  2. The clear sign of a tape recorded on a misaligned vcr. Best solution would be to misalign (the exit guide) on purpose, a bit risky but i did it before. Just use a 2nd vcr of less value for that.
